Congrats on the surgery. Hope you continue to do great. Do you know why you were not required to do a pre op Liquid Protein diet?

Your liver lies in front of your stomach. So it has to be manipulated in order to perform the sleeve. The pre op liquid diet helps to eliminate the visceral fat around the liver. Plus dehydration is critical post op. If you start off well dehydrated it will lessen your chances of becoming dehydrate post op.

I was obviously heavily sedated when I half read your question. The reason I didn't have to do a pre op Protein diet is because my bmi was 37 (which is less than 40). I was approved for surgery bc I have really bad sleep apnea. I did the pre op diet because I gain 10+lbs having food funerals. The day of my surgery I was 216.4lbs.

Hi everybody!! Super excited to have found this thread. My dad is black and my mom white and I have a mix of genes from both sides.... High blood pressure from my dad. Scarring easily and wounds take longer to heal (no diabetes). Curly hair. I'm worried about the wounds taking longer to heal and with scarring. I'm also worried about losing my hair.

Five days out and I'm having trouble getting in the required protein! Any suggestions?

It's really tough to get your Protein the first week or two - the stomach is still angry from the surgery and swollen. If you can tolerate Protein Shakes Premeir has ones that have 30 grams of protein. Its easy to have two of them in a day to get to 60 grams. It is difficult to get there with food, unless you puree a steak or something. I am diabetic and my wounds healed very quickly. But I suppose that most of that is due to genetics.
